The 734 papers published in Revista Iberoamericana de Automática e Informática Industrial RIAI in the last decades have received a total of 2.8k indexed citations. Papers published in Revista Iberoamericana de Automática e Informática Industrial RIAI usually cover Control and Systems Engineering (360 papers), Electrical and Electronic Engineering (96 papers) and Biomedical Engineering (93 papers) specifically the topics of Advanced Control Systems Optimization (132 papers), Fault Detection and Control Systems (85 papers) and Adaptive Control of Nonlinear Systems (62 papers). The most active scholars publishing in Revista Iberoamericana de Automática e Informática Industrial RIAI are Matilde Santos, Carlos Bordons, Ramón Vilanova, José Manuel Andújar, José Luís Guzmán, Manuel Berenguel, J. Sánchez, S. Dormido, Félix García-Torres and Eduardo F. Camacho.
